2009-07-31 33 views
1

我创建使用的VisualSVN导入到主干不起作用龟颠覆

MyCompanyRepository 
    Project1 
     branches 
     tags 
     trunk 

我复制的URL关闭后备箱文件夹下面的版本库结构。然后我去了我的c:\ www \ Project1文件夹,并右键单击它并做了TortoiseSVN |导入和网址是https://ourserver/svn/MyCompanyRepository/Project1/trunk

它添加了文件,但我的文件夹似乎没有在源代码管理中。我的意思是这些文件存在于服务器的中继线上,但在本地,我没有任何地方的.svn。那么我做错了什么?我没有标志显示我的文件夹在svn下运行,什么也没有。

回答

1

你必须从SVN回购中检出文件到磁盘:导入并不意味着创建本地工作副本。

+0

啊,没错!我还注意到,在结帐时,您需要清除检出目录路径中的项目名称,否则它将创建一个不是您想要的新文件夹。 – PositiveGuy 2009-07-31 15:33:05

1

导入不会自动将您导入的目录转换为Subversion调用工作副本的内容。您需要删除c:\ www \ project1中的所有内容并进行结帐,或者在空目录中结帐并复制所有内容。

0

导入不会在本地创建结帐 - 您需要从TortoiseSVN运行结帐以获取文件。